I've reviewed bacon from BACONFREAK before... the bacons are generally too oily, overly flavored (I particularly didn't like their Cajun bacon) and over-cured (evidenced by the deep translucence in the fat).  You can look at the headlines to find my previous posts on this bacon.  So I would caution you about ordering it for home cooking and use... but the chocolate goodies!  They look great!

ROAD BACON!  This week, I've been on the road and unable to prepare my usual bacon review of home-cooked commercially available fare.  However, here are two bacons from the road.

The first is a bacon cheeseburger at Kodiak Jack's in Oshkosh, Wisconsin


Outstanding burger, cool ambiance with lots of taxidermy products (you don't see that every day!) at Jack's, and just good bacon.

The second was a road bacon & eggs breakfast at a Marriott.  I am a big Marriott traveler and use the chain whenever I can.  This one was perfectly cooked crispy bacon in a warmer, with a side of scrambled eggs.  Most hotel self-serve bacon, eggs and sausage is limp, overcooked and flavorless.  But Marriott gets it right.
